What is a MA Limited X Ray?

MA Limited X-Ray positions refer to Medical Assistants who are trained and certified to perform a limited range of X-ray imaging procedures in addition to their regular clinical duties. These professionals typically assist physicians by taking basic radiographic images, such as chest or extremity X-rays, under the supervision of a radiologist or physician. They play a vital role in healthcare settings by streamlining patient care and diagnostic processes. However, their scope of practice is restricted compared to fully licensed radiologic technologists, and they must follow strict guidelines regarding the types of X-rays they are permitted to perform.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a MA Limited X Ray?

To thrive as a Limited X-Ray Machine Operator, you typically need a high school diploma, completion of a limited radiography program, and state licensure or certification. Familiarity with X-ray equipment, digital imaging systems, and safety protocols is essential for daily operations. Strong attention to detail, patient communication, and organizational skills help ensure accurate imaging and positive patient experiences. These competencies are vital for producing high-quality diagnostic images while maintaining patient safety and regulatory compliance.

What are some typical challenges faced by MA Limited X Ray professionals, and how can they be addressed?

MA Limited X-Ray professionals often face challenges such as managing a high patient volume while maintaining accurate imaging and adhering to strict safety protocols. They must also ensure effective communication with both patients and the broader medical team, especially when patients are anxious or have mobility limitations. Staying up to date with evolving technology and regulatory requirements is key, as is participating in ongoing training. Building strong organizational and interpersonal skills can help address these challenges and ensure high-quality patient care.

Is it hard to become a Ma Limited X Ray?

Becoming a Medical Assistant (MA) with X-ray certification typically requires completing a post-secondary program in medical assisting or radiologic technology, which can take several months to a year. Certification or licensing may be required depending on the state or employer, and knowledge of radiography equipment and safety procedures is essential.
